Also saw a reference there to Paul Rotter - the worlds most successful scalper.....interesting one of his comments:
"Q: why don't you have any problems with closing out the position and even taking the opposite direction? shouldn't a trader stick to his opinion?
A: no, definitely not. an analyst or some kind of guru has to stick to it, but as a trader you should have no opinion. the more opinion you have, the harder gets it to get out of a losing position."
